Hi Dominik,

Today's linux-next merge of the pcmcia tree got a conflict in
drivers/net/pcmcia/xirc2ps_cs.c between commit
8e95a2026f3b43f7c3d676adaccd2de9532e8dcc ("drivers/net: Move && and || to
end of previous line") from the net tree and commit
dddfbd824b96a25da0b2f1cf35c0be33ef2422fe ("pcmcia: convert net pcmcia
drivers to use new CIS helpers") from the pcmcia tree.

I fixed it up (by using the pcmcia tree version - since that removed the
conflicting code that was modified in the net tree commit) and can carry
the fix as necessary.
